Simon not understanding the reason people get fined more the richer they are is so strange for me. Obviously they should pay more, because fines should always be based on income since it's supposed to punish you. If 60 pounds is punishing a poor guy, it's only tickling a rich guy. The rich guy and poor guy murdering somebody is a great example but not a great point of view from all three. If a rich guy and a poor guy both kill someone the exact same way they should both get the same time. The punishment in the example is based on punishment on the lifespan and since you cannot predict how long someone can live you just have a sentence that on average would be the same % of years off of people's life for everyone. But with fines it's not the same thing if you take the same amount of money from everyone. Which is why you should fine based on income.

I think what the guys were struggling with is the difference between a civil and criminal offence. As long as a speeding ticket is paid on time it's a civil offence not criminal. I agree that civil offences are classist but shouldn't be. Criminal offences, where it relates to permanent records and jail time, should be uniform for all regardless of income. (I know very little about the law so correct me if I'm wrong)
